    Getting Around Lang Lang Without Having to Drive

    Lang Lang is different from a metropolitan suburb where several train and tram routes may be available nearby. The township does not have its own railway station, so residents who need to connect with the metropolitan rail network may first need to travel by road to another transport hub.

    This is one reason taxi travel can be useful for local residents. For example, someone starting their working day in Melbourne may need a taxi from their Lang Lang home to Pakenham Station before continuing by train. Another passenger may need to travel in the opposite direction after arriving in the area.

    Local Knowledge Matters in a Regional Town

    Taxi travel in a regional area is not always the same as travelling within Melbourne. Distances between towns are greater, rural roads can connect with major routes, and a passenger’s pickup location may be well outside a traditional town centre.

    Lang Lang’s location provides road connections towards Pakenham, Koo Wee Rup, Cranbourne and other parts of the region. Having the correct pickup address and destination is therefore important when arranging a journey.
